ネム(XEM)を支える技術と特徴まとめ
ネム(NEM)は、ブロックチェーン技術を活用したプラットフォームであり、その独特なアーキテクチャと機能により、金融業界をはじめとする様々な分野での応用が期待されています。本稿では、ネムを支える主要な技術要素と、その特徴について詳細に解説します。
1. ブロックチェーン技術の基礎
ネムは、分散型台帳技術であるブロックチェーンを基盤としています。ブロックチェーンは、取引履歴をブロックと呼ばれる単位で記録し、それらを鎖のように連結することで、データの改ざんを困難にしています。この仕組みにより、高いセキュリティと透明性を実現しています。ネムのブロックチェーンは、プルーフ・オブ・インポートランス(Proof of Importance: POI)という独自のコンセンサスアルゴリズムを採用しており、これがネムの重要な特徴の一つです。
2. プルーフ・オブ・インポートランス(POI)
POIは、従来のプルーフ・オブ・ワーク(Proof of Work: POW)やプルーフ・オブ・ステーク(Proof of Stake: POS)とは異なるコンセンサスアルゴリズムです。POWは計算能力を競い、POSは保有量に応じてブロック生成権限を与えますが、POIはネットワークへの貢献度を重視します。具体的には、保有量だけでなく、ネットワークへの取引量やハーベスト(後述)の頻度などが考慮されます。これにより、単なる富の集中ではなく、ネットワークの活性化に貢献するユーザーに報酬が与えられる仕組みとなっています。POIは、エネルギー消費を抑え、より公平なブロック生成を実現することを目的としています。
3. ネムのアーキテクチャ
ネムのアーキテクチャは、以下の要素で構成されています。
3.1. ネームスペース(Namespace)
ネームスペースは、アカウント名やモザイク(後述)などの情報を登録するための領域です。これにより、ユーザーは人間が理解しやすい名前でアカウントや資産を管理することができます。ネームスペースは階層構造を持ち、組織やプロジェクトごとに独自のネームスペースを構築することが可能です。
3.2. モザイク(Mosaic)
モザイクは、ネム上で発行可能なトークンです。独自のトークンを発行することで、様々な用途に合わせた資産を表現することができます。例えば、企業のポイントプログラムや、特定のプロジェクトの資金調達などに利用することができます。モザイクは、ネムのブロックチェーン上で安全に管理され、取引することができます。
3.3. トランザクション(Transaction)
トランザクションは、ネム上で行われる取引の記録です。ネムのトランザクションは、送金だけでなく、モザイクの発行やネームスペースの登録など、様々な操作を実行することができます。トランザクションは、デジタル署名によって保護されており、改ざんを防ぐことができます。
3.4. ハーベスト(Harvest)
ハーベストは、POIコンセンサスアルゴリズムにおいて、ブロック生成権限を獲得するためのプロセスです。ユーザーは、一定量のXEMを保有し、ネットワークに接続することで、ハーベストに参加することができます。ハーベストに参加することで、ブロック生成に貢献し、報酬を得ることができます。ハーベストは、ネットワークのセキュリティを維持し、分散化を促進する役割を果たしています。
4. ネムの主な特徴
4.1. 高いセキュリティ
ネムは、ブロックチェーン技術とPOIコンセンサスアルゴリズムにより、高いセキュリティを実現しています。データの改ざんを困難にし、不正な取引を防ぐことができます。また、デジタル署名によってトランザクションを保護し、ユーザーの資産を安全に管理することができます。
4.2. スケーラビリティ
ネムは、POIコンセンサスアルゴリズムにより、高いスケーラビリティを実現しています。従来のPOWやPOSと比較して、より多くのトランザクションを処理することができます。これにより、大規模なアプリケーションやサービスの構築に適しています。
4.3. カスタマイズ性
ネムは、APIやSDKが充実しており、開発者が容易にアプリケーションを構築することができます。また、モザイクやネームスペースなどの機能により、様々な用途に合わせたカスタマイズが可能です。これにより、特定のニーズに合わせたソリューションを開発することができます。
4.4. 柔軟な資産管理
モザイク機能により、様々な種類の資産をネム上で表現することができます。これにより、従来の金融システムでは困難だった、柔軟な資産管理を実現することができます。例えば、企業のポイントプログラムや、特定のプロジェクトの資金調達などに利用することができます。
4.5. 迅速なトランザクション
ネムのトランザクションは、比較的迅速に処理されます。これにより、リアルタイムでの取引や決済が可能になります。これは、POIコンセンサスアルゴリズムの効率性と、ネットワークの最適化によるものです。
5. ネムの応用事例
ネムは、その特徴を活かして、様々な分野での応用が期待されています。
5.1. サプライチェーン管理
ネムのブロックチェーン技術は、サプライチェーンの透明性を高め、トレーサビリティを向上させることができます。これにより、製品の偽造や不正流通を防ぐことができます。
5.2. デジタルID管理
ネムのネームスペース機能は、デジタルID管理に活用することができます。これにより、安全かつ効率的な本人確認システムを構築することができます。
5.3. 投票システム
ネムのブロックチェーン技術は、投票システムの透明性と信頼性を高めることができます。これにより、不正な投票や改ざんを防ぐことができます。
5.4. 金融サービス
ネムのモザイク機能は、新しい金融サービスの開発を可能にします。例えば、独自のトークンを発行し、資金調達やポイントプログラムなどを構築することができます。
5.5. 不動産取引
ネムのブロックチェーン技術は、不動産取引の透明性を高め、手続きを簡素化することができます。これにより、取引コストを削減し、効率的な不動産取引を実現することができます。
6. ネムの将来展望
ネムは、ブロックチェーン技術の進化とともに、さらなる発展が期待されています。POIコンセンサスアルゴリズムの改良や、新しい機能の追加により、より高いセキュリティ、スケーラビリティ、カスタマイズ性を実現することが可能です。また、様々な分野での応用事例の増加により、ネムの普及が進むことが予想されます。ネムは、ブロックチェーン技術の可能性を広げ、社会に貢献するプラットフォームとなることを目指しています。
まとめ
ネム(XEM)は、POIという独自のコンセンサスアルゴリズム、ネームスペース、モザイクといった特徴的な技術要素によって支えられています。これらの技術は、高いセキュリティ、スケーラビリティ、カスタマイズ性、柔軟な資産管理、迅速なトランザクションを実現し、サプライチェーン管理、デジタルID管理、投票システム、金融サービス、不動産取引など、多岐にわたる分野での応用を可能にします。ネムは、ブロックチェーン技術の可能性を追求し、社会に貢献するプラットフォームとして、今後も発展を続けていくでしょう。